A train trip from Audley End to Selby takes about 3hrs 53 mins on average, covering roughly 133 miles (215 kilometres). With around 10 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£15.90,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Nestled in the picturesque region of North Yorkshire, Selby train station is more than just a transit point—it's your gateway to the incredible landscapes and bustling cities that lie ahead. Whether you're commuting for work, visiting family, or exploring the beautiful English countryside, Selby station offers a range of amenities and transport links to make your journey as smooth as possible. Let's uncover what this charming station has in store for you.
At Selby station, you'll find a well-managed ticket office with convenient hours—open from 06:00 to 19:45 Monday to Saturday, and 09:15 to 19:00 on Sundays. Ticket machines are available for collecting online purchases, and are fully accessible for all passengers. Smartcards can be issued here, but note that smartcard validators aren't present.
The station is equipped with several features to assist passengers, including an induction loop and customer help points. Don't hesitate to speak with station staff available during most hours for any travel assistance. CCTV ensures additional safety for peace of mind.
For those with accessibility needs, Selby station offers step-free access throughout, with ramps available for train boarding. However, it's important to plan ahead using the accessible assistance service by contacting TransPennine Express, ensuring a hassle-free journey.
Getting to and from Selby station is straightforward, with a taxi rank conveniently located outside the station. Selby is also well-connected by local bus services, ideal for your onward journey. If rail services are disrupted, a replacement bus service runs from outside the station entrance.
Whether you're heading towards the vibrant city life of Leeds or exploring the historic streets of York, you'll find numerous destinations at your fingertips from Selby station. Visits to London King's Cross, bustling Hull, and the fascinating Manchester Piccadilly are just a train ride away. Looking for something closer? Don't miss routes to nearby gems like Howden, South Milford, and Bridlington.
To ensure you're ready for your next adventure, refreshment facilities such as a coffee shop located in the booking hall offer the perfect pitstop. The station also features heated waiting rooms on both platforms, although it does not offer currency exchange or ATM services.
